Step 1: Choose an Editing App
First, you need to select an editing app that allows you to add text or stickers to your photos. There are several options available on the Google Play Store, such as Snapseed, Pixlr, or Adobe Photoshop Express. Depending on your editing preferences, choose an app that suits your needs and install it on your Android device.
Step 2: Select a Photo
Once you have installed the editing app, open it and select the photo you want to add the question mark to. You can either choose a photo from your camera roll or take a new picture using the app’s camera function.
Step 3: Add Text or Sticker
Next, find the option to add text or stickers to your photo within the editing app. This feature is usually located in the toolbar or editing menu. Once you’ve located it, tap on it to proceed.
Step 4: Customize the Question Mark
Now is the time to add the much-awaited question mark to your photo. Look for the font or sticker option that offers a question mark symbol. There are usually numerous font styles and sticker designs to choose from, so pick the one that matches the theme or mood of your photo.
Step 5: Adjust Size and Placement
After selecting the question mark symbol, you might need to adjust its size and placement on your photo. Most editing apps allow you to resize, rotate, and move the added text or sticker. Experiment with different sizes and positions until you find the perfect spot for your question mark.
Step 6: Customize Text and Color (optional)
If you want to personalize the question mark further, you can edit the text’s color, font style, or add a different background color. This step is entirely optional and depends on your preference and creativity.
Step 7: Save and Share
Once you are satisfied with the placement and customization of your question mark, save the edited photo to your device. The save button is usually located in the top right corner of the app’s interface. After saving, you can now share your enhanced photo with family, friends, or on social media platforms directly from the app.
